The recipe I found used a couple of different pretzel shapes, and you can use what you would like. I used square pretzels, and round ones would also be good. I did see a different recipe with triangles, topped to candies to make it look like little trees. You have the option of using candies other than Rolos, and you could make quite a few different varieties with all of the special flavors out there right now.
The hardest part of this recipe is pressing the chocolate candies into the Rolo after softening it in the oven! It’s pretty sticky. The large sprinkles I used are a little too small, so I think I will make some more and top them with chocolate candies (M&Ms or Smarties). They are small, but cute, and are a fun addition to any gathering you may have this time of year.
30 pretzels
30 Rolo candies/Hershey’s Kisses
30 chocolate candies/large holiday sprinkles
Holiday sprinkles
Heat the oven to 250 degrees. Line a baking sheet with a silicone baking mat.
Place the pretzels on the baking sheet. Top with a Rolo candy.
Place in the oven for about 5 minutes, until the candy starts to get soft. Remove from the oven and top each pretzel with a chocolate candy or holiday sprinkles, pressing down as you add the candy.
Sprinkle with additional holiday sprinkles if desired. Allow the chocolate candies to cool completely before serving.
